Understanding What Is A CBC Lab?
A CBC lab, or Complete Blood Count laboratory test, is one of the most common and essential blood tests performed in healthcare. It provides a detailed snapshot of your blood’s cellular components, including red blood cells, white blood cells, and platelets. Doctors rely on this test to evaluate your general health status or diagnose various medical conditions like infections, anemia, and blood disorders.
The test involves drawing a small sample of blood, usually from a vein in your arm. This sample is then analyzed using automated machines that count and measure different types of cells. The results offer vital clues about how well your body is functioning and whether there’s an underlying problem that needs attention.
The Key Components Measured in a CBC Lab
A Complete Blood Count isn’t just one number—it’s a collection of several measurements that together paint a picture of your blood health. Here are the main components measured:
Red Blood Cells (RBC)
Red blood cells carry oxygen from your lungs to the rest of your body. The CBC counts how many RBCs you have and measures their size and hemoglobin content. Low RBC counts can indicate anemia, while high counts might suggest dehydration or other conditions.
White Blood Cells (WBC)
White blood cells are your body’s defense against infection. The CBC measures their total number and sometimes breaks down the different types (like neutrophils and lymphocytes). An elevated WBC count often signals infection or inflammation; a low count may point to immune system problems.
Hemoglobin (Hb or Hgb)
Hemoglobin is the protein inside red blood cells that carries oxygen. Measuring hemoglobin levels helps identify anemia or other blood disorders.
Hematocrit (Hct)
Hematocrit indicates the percentage of red blood cells in your total blood volume. It helps assess hydration status and blood disorders.
Platelets
Platelets help with clotting to stop bleeding. The CBC measures how many platelets you have; too few can cause bleeding problems, too many may increase clot risk.
How Does a CBC Lab Test Work?
The process behind a CBC lab test is straightforward but precise. First, a healthcare professional collects a small amount of your blood using a needle—usually from a vein in your arm. This step is quick but requires care to avoid discomfort or bruising.
Once collected, the sample is sent to the laboratory where specialized machines analyze it. These automated analyzers use principles like light scattering and electrical impedance to count and size each type of cell accurately. Some labs also use microscopes for manual review if abnormalities are detected.
The entire analysis takes just minutes in modern labs, but results may take hours to days depending on where you get tested. Once complete, doctors review these numbers alongside symptoms or other tests to make informed decisions about diagnosis or treatment.
Normal Ranges Explained: What Should You Expect?
Understanding the numbers from a CBC lab can be confusing without context. Normal ranges vary slightly between labs but generally fall within these guidelines:
| Component | Normal Range | Significance |
|---|---|---|
| Red Blood Cells (RBC) | 4.7–6.1 million cells/µL (men) 4.2–5.4 million cells/µL (women) |
Oxygen transport; low levels may indicate anemia |
| White Blood Cells (WBC) | 4,500–11,000 cells/µL | Infection defense; high levels suggest infection/inflammation |
| Hemoglobin (Hb) | 13.8–17.2 g/dL (men) 12.1–15.1 g/dL (women) |
Carries oxygen; low values often mean anemia |
| Hematocrit (Hct) | 40.7%–50.3% (men) 36.1%–44.3% (women) |
% of RBCs in blood volume; indicates hydration & anemia |
| Platelets | 150,000–450,000 platelets/µL | Aids clotting; abnormal counts affect bleeding/clot risks |
These ranges provide doctors with benchmarks but must be interpreted alongside symptoms and other tests for accurate diagnosis.
The Importance of Regular CBC Lab Tests
Routine CBC lab tests play an essential role in preventive healthcare by catching problems early before symptoms appear or worsen. For example, anemia can develop slowly over months without obvious signs until fatigue becomes overwhelming.
Doctors often order CBCs during physical exams or before surgery to ensure patients are healthy enough for procedures. They’re also critical in monitoring chronic illnesses like cancer or autoimmune diseases where changes in blood cell counts can signal progression or complications.
For people experiencing unexplained symptoms like persistent fatigue, fever, bruising easily, or infections that won’t heal, a CBC lab test provides valuable clues that guide further investigation.
Common Conditions Detected Through CBC Labs
CBC labs help detect numerous health issues by showing abnormalities in blood cell counts or characteristics:
- Anemia: Low RBCs or hemoglobin causing tiredness and weakness.
- Infections: Elevated white cell counts typically indicate bacterial or viral infections.
- Bleeding Disorders: Platelet abnormalities can lead to excessive bleeding or clotting.
- Cancers: Leukemia and lymphoma often cause abnormal WBC counts.
- Nutritional Deficiencies: Low RBCs might reflect iron, vitamin B12, or folate shortages.
- Bone Marrow Problems: Diseases affecting marrow production show up as abnormal cell counts.
Because these conditions vary widely in severity and treatment needs, timely CBC testing helps doctors intervene early for better outcomes.
The Role of Technology in Modern CBC Labs
Technological advances have transformed how CBC labs operate today compared to decades ago when manual counting was standard practice. Modern hematology analyzers use lasers, flow cytometry, and digital imaging to deliver fast results with remarkable accuracy.
These machines not only count cells but also analyze their size distribution and shape variations—important clues for diagnosing specific diseases like sickle cell anemia or certain leukemias.
Automation reduces human error while increasing throughput so labs can handle hundreds of samples daily without compromising quality standards set by regulatory bodies like CLIA (Clinical Laboratory Improvement Amendments).
Results from automated systems are integrated into electronic health records immediately upon completion—speeding up diagnosis times dramatically compared to older workflows reliant on paper reports.

The Safety and Preparation for Getting a CBC Lab Test
A CBC lab test is safe with minimal risks involved:
- Blood draw discomfort is usually brief.
- Minor bruising at puncture site may occur.
- No special preparation like fasting is generally needed unless ordered by your doctor.
If you’re nervous about needles or have difficult veins for drawing blood, inform the technician beforehand so they can take extra care during collection.
Since it’s such a routine procedure performed millions of times daily worldwide without complications, there’s little reason for concern beyond typical mild discomfort during the needle stick itself.
The Cost Factor: How Much Does A CBC Lab Test Cost?
The price for a Complete Blood Count varies widely depending on location:
| Description | Price Range (USD) | Additional Notes |
|---|---|---|
| CBC Test at Hospital Lab | $30 – $100+ | Billed through insurance mostly; prices vary by region/hospital. |
| CBC at Independent Clinic/Lab | $25 – $70 | No insurance needed if paying out-of-pocket; convenient walk-in options available. |
| CBC as Part of Health Screening Package | $50 – $150+ | Might include other tests bundled together; cost-effective for full checkups. |
Insurance coverage often reduces out-of-pocket costs significantly if medically necessary tests are ordered by doctors following guidelines.
It’s wise to check with providers ahead if cost is an issue since some labs offer discounts for self-paying patients without insurance involvement.
The Impact Of Age And Gender On CBC Lab Values
Blood values measured by a CBC lab aren’t static throughout life—they shift due to age-related changes and biological differences between genders:
- Newborns typically show higher WBC counts than adults.
- Elderly people may experience lower bone marrow production leading to slightly reduced RBCs.
- Men generally have higher hemoglobin levels than women due largely to hormonal influences.
Doctors interpret results considering these factors so they don’t mistake normal variations for disease states unnecessarily.
Age-specific reference ranges exist precisely because what’s normal at one life stage might not be at another—making personalized interpretation essential rather than relying on generic cutoffs alone.
Troubleshooting Abnormal Results From A CBC Lab Test
Abnormal findings don’t always spell disaster but should never be ignored either:
- Low RBCs could mean anything from temporary iron deficiency caused by diet changes all the way up to serious bone marrow diseases requiring urgent care.
- High WBC counts might reflect simple viral infections resolving on their own or more serious chronic inflammatory conditions needing specialist attention.
- Platelet abnormalities could be transient after infections or signal autoimmune diseases needing treatment.
When faced with unexpected results from “What Is A CBC Lab?” testing remember it’s just one piece in the puzzle—your doctor will likely order follow-up tests such as peripheral smear examination or specific markers depending on initial findings before concluding diagnosis pathways.
